Ok boys and girls here is the Official Mego Meet 2015 Exclusive figure. I am proud to present Amalgam Comics Super-Soldier.

Figure will come with head, body, suit, belt, boots, "S" shield and sticker emblem. He will come in a WGSH style box. Special thanks to Doc, Paul, Austin and Mike for their help.

Cost will be $65. They are limited to 30 total figures with one unique figure for the customs auction.

Just like last year you can pay to reserve your figure weather you can attend or not. I will either bring it to you at the Meet or I will mail it to you after the show.

So there is no misunderstanding:

Head done by me (copied by Austin)
Suit by Austin
Belt by me
Body and boots by Doc
Shield & sticker by LaserMego
Box by Mego73

Many figures were discussed last year at MM. Some will still be done but later and I may change what I had originally wanted to do for next year already, lol.

The customs figure will be a "new" character created by me. It will be the "Bizarro Super-Soldier" figure. He'll have a different color belt and hair, come on a gray body, have a crescent moon sticker and a backwards "S" shield. He's still a work in progress.

I've already done Dr. StrangeFate for myself. And I am working on Iron Lantern, Amazon, Bruce Wayne Agent of S.H.I.E.L.D., Dark Claw and a couple of others.
